Claim that court ruling could cost airline over €5m 'absurd', says Ryanair

Millions of Ryanair passengers could be in line for a payout after a landmark court judgment in the UK ruled that the airline cannot limit the time allowed to claim compensation for flight delays.

Lawyers say the Irish airline could be liable for payouts of around £610m (€856m) after the firm lost a test case at Manchester County Court.
